Abstract

A material that is both strong and light is essential for industry. There are many methods for enhancing mechanical properties and microstructure. The mechanical properties of metals can be enhanced using equal channel angular pressing (ECAP) and severe plastic deformation (SPD), both of which are effective techniques. Processes of SPD are defined as a group of metal working techniques in which a very large plastic strain is imposed on a bulk material to make an ultra-fine-grained (UFG) metal. One of the most widely used and successful grain refining methods for SPD is ECAP. In this process, the die is essential. Friction, the corner angle, the total number of passes, the channel angle, Routes, back pressure, and other variables can all have an impact on the process’s result. To provide a more accurate result for evaluating different aluminum (AL) alloys. The variables of the ECAP method were examined and applied to room-temperature (RT) aluminum alloys (AA) with rectangular cross sections, encompassing samples of various industrially significant AA-7075, AA-6061, and AA-1050.
